"Bono, say it isn't so"
Both sides, now.


IRISH rocker-turned-global do-gooder Bono has been keeping busy lately, challenging the president to increase aid to the world's poor and launching his new "Red" campaign to fight HIV and AIDS in Africa. But behind the scenes, the New York Post reports that his firm, Elevation Partners, is in talks to buy Take-Two Interactive, the troubled video-game company responsible for the not-so-globally-conscious game "Grand Theft Auto".

The deal could be worth more than $1 billion, including debt. That's a far cry from when Bono helped work on another debt -- $40 billion owed by the world's poorest countries.
